调整Redis的最大连接数以提升性能(redis的最大连接数)
Redis(简介写的内存高速存储+数据库)是一个著名的高性能内存数据库,它具有高性能、高可用性和高扩展性等特点,广泛应用于互联网开发中,以提升网站性能和稳定性。Redis客户端会与Redis服务器建立连接,以访问Redis服务器上的数据,这些连接可以保持活动,也可以被关闭。一旦Redis服务器连接数超过设定的最大数量,新的连接将被拒绝,从而影响Redis服务器的性能。因此,为了提高Redis服务器的性能表现,有必要调整可接受的最大连接数。
调整Redis的最大连接数需要编辑Redis的服务配置文件,文件路径存储在环境变量REDIS_CONF中,编辑配置文件后,需要使用以下命令重启Redis服务,以使调整生效:
sudo service redis-server restart
在配置文件中,指定最大连接数的配置选项为maxclients,其默认值为10000,例如将最大连接数设置为50000:
maxclients 50000
除此之外,Redis还有一些其它可以用来提升性能的配置,比如,如果服务器上有足够多的内存可以分配给Redis,则可以更改maxmemory参数,以使Redis分配更多的内存。
最后,调整Redis的最大连接数以外,还有其它一些性能指标,需要合理调优来保证Redis的最佳性能表现,例如:内存分配,I/O设置,线程设置等。如果有一些误入数据,可以考虑使用配置项maxmemory-policy来定时清理错误数据,以最大限度地提高Redis的性能。